    I am seriously thinking about moving to HK and I was hoping to get some help from the wise people on this board. My husband has an offer from HK that he really wants to take, and we have one week to decide.

    I currently work in pharmaceutical R&D in the US. My questions are:

    1) Is it possible to work in biotech/pharma R&D with only English?

    2) How is the work/life balance in biotech/pharma industry? I searched on this forum and read lots of information on finance and teaching, but didn't see anything for R&D.

    3) Are most biotech/pharma located in the science park? Is it a good idea to commute to Shenzhen? We will most likely live near Sha Tin, although I don't know the area at all.

    Thank you so much in advance for your help!


  2. #2

    There are no major biotech or pharma companies with R&D labs in HK that I am aware of. The Science Park will have small biomedical/health diagnostics companies where your science skills could be useful. The HK universities might have post-doctoral research positions that involve R&D in the area you specialise in.

    Whether it is a good idea or not to commute from HK to Shenzhen to work will probably depend on where the job is based. I personally think it'll be too stressful to do this in the long term.
